What is the Saber Certificate?

The Saber Certificate is a critical document in the import system of Saudi Arabia, which was implemented to guarantee that imported products adhere to the Kingdom's stringent safety and quality standards. It functions as a conformance gateway, simplifying the approval process for a variety of products Saber Certificate Cost in Saudi Arabia market.

What is the necessity of the Saber Certificate?

Saudi Arabia's Vision 2030 prioritizes the enhancement of consumer safety and product quality. The Saber Certificate is consistent with this vision by mandating precise adherence to the regulations of the Saudi Standards, Metrology, and Quality Organization (SASO).

Saber System Overview

The Saber system is an electronic platform that is intended to simplify the process of issuing conformity certificates for both regulated and non-regulated products. It allows manufacturers and importers to:

Confirm that Saudi standards are being followed.

Acquire pertinent product certifications.

Facilitate the expediting of customs clearance procedures.

Cost Analysis of the Saber Certificate

Cost Influencers

The cost of obtaining a Saber Certificate can be influenced by a variety of factors, such as:

Product Type: The costs of regulated products are frequently elevated by the necessity of conducting additional testing.

Import Volume: Certification requirements may be more stringent for larger quantities.

Certification Body Fees: The fee structures of various certification bodies may differ.

Registration Fees: Standard

The registration cost for a Saber Certificate typically ranges from SAR 500 to SAR 2,000 per product. The fees may fluctuate based on the product type and the certification body.

Additional Fees Clarified

Importers may confront the following in addition to registration fees:

Testing Fees: Regulated products are subject to these fees.

Consultancy Fees: Although optional, they are advantageous for the management of intricate compliance procedures.

Certificates with expiration dates are subject to renewal fees.

Procedures for Acquiring a Saber Certificate

Pre-Application Requirements

Prior to submitting your application, verify that you possess the following:

Detailed product documentation.

Compliance reports.

Identification of the appropriate certification body.

Registration Procedure

Access the Saber Portal by logging in: Establish an account and input product information.

Choose a Certification Body: Select from organizations that have been authorized by SASO.

Documentation Submission: Upload compliance reports and pertinent documents.

Complete the payment for processing by paying the fees.

Get the Saber Certificate: After it has been approved, you can download it.

Timeline for Approval

The entire process typically takes 5-10 business days, provided that all documents are accurate and comprehensive.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

What is the cost of a Saber Certificate in Saudi Arabia?

The cost of each product typically falls within the range of SAR 500 to SAR 2,000, contingent upon the product type and certification body.

How long does it take to obtain a Saber Certificate?

All necessary documents must be in order for the process to be completed, which typically takes 5-10 business days.

Are there any penalties for noncompliance?

Indeed, noncompliance may result in product bans, shipment delays, or penalties.

Is the Saber Certificate a requirement for all imports?

Indeed, it is compulsory for both regulated and non-regulated products to enter Saudi Arabia.

Is it possible to submit applications for multiple certificates simultaneously?

Indeed, the Saber system enables importers to submit applications for multiple certificates simultaneously.

Is there a discount available for applications submitted in bulk?

Bulk applications may qualify for discounts from certain certification bodies. It is advisable to contact the certification body of your choice directly.
